Successfully Navigating Cleanroom Projects: The Importance of a Devoted Project Manager
The intricacies of cleanroom environments demand meticulous planning and execution. A passionate project manager acts as the backbone ensuring seamless completion of projects within these sensitive spaces. They utilize their skills to coordinate all aspects, from design and construction to validation and qualification.
- Key tasks they handle include:
- Setting project scope, goals, and timelines.
- Partnering cross-functional teams, including engineers, technicians, and regulatory staff.
- Overseeing budget and resource allocation throughout the project lifecycle.
- Ensuring strict adherence to industry standards and regulatory requirements.
A successful cleanroom project manager is not only technically proficient but also possesses strong communication skills. They effectively relay information, mitigate conflicts, and guide teams to achieve project success within the demanding constraints of a cleanroom environment.

Cleanroom Constructions: Navigate Complexity with Effective Project Management
Constructing a cleanroom demands meticulous planning and execution. It's a complex undertaking requiring adherence to stringent regulations and standards. To guarantee a smooth construction process, implementing effective project management practices is crucial.
- Meticulous Pre-Construction Planning forms the bedrock of any successful cleanroom build. This involves defining clear targets, establishing a detailed timeline, and identifying potential obstacles upfront.
- Open Lines of Communication among all stakeholders, including architects, engineers, contractors, and regulatory inspectors, is paramount. Regular meetings and progress updates facilitate transparency and address any issues promptly.
- Quality control measures must be established throughout the construction phase to ensure compliance with established cleanroom standards. This involves regular inspections, testing, and documentation of materials, workmanship, and final product.
By embracing these project management principles, you can master the complexities of cleanroom construction, delivering a facility that satisfies your specific requirements and operates at peak efficiency.
